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8840840548 28 7131
213426639 520551 78338255780
213426639 520551 78338255780
56 798 29378 09943378676 224978355
All about undefined
Interested in learning more?
213426639 520551 78338255780
56 798 29378 09943378676 224978355
See more
21703793625 1101543730
8507 899566 85211018
See more
0206 882872 1939888
52959 228085150 487528 74371
See more